Check the seat map in your reservation details - The 777-300ER with Kosmo Suites 2.0 has a galley and lavs between Rows 7 and 8. Business Class is also a 2-2-2 configuration.

The `old` version of the 777-300ER has a galley and lavs between Rows 8 and 9, and Business Class has a 2-3-2 configuration.
